In recent days, the London Metal Exchange is showing signs of emerging copper deficit. This is indicated by a surge in premiums on contracts of the metal with immediate delivery compared to contracts for a later date.

Gold emerged as another in-demand asset last year. Global central banks boosted their bullion reserves by over 1,000 tons, a record amount, doubling the annual level seen in the previous decade.
The European Union is ready to make another attempt to reach a free trade agreement with Australia. The parties have been trying to secure the deal since 2018, but now they face a common threat—Donald Trump's aggressive import tariffs, Bloomberg reports.
Over the month, the Canadian dollar has shown the strongest performance among G10 currencies, according to Investing.com. However, ING analysts view the loonie's prospects as less attractive compared to other G10 currencies.
